Invisible Men Intro:
The Invisible Men (Muzza and Dom) are the originators of London's small but highly successful Condition, based in Brixton and Shoreditch. This is no mean feat as they live here in Liverpool and must travel down to the capital twice a month. Eclectic Junk & Sure-Fire Funk is their trademark sound, taking in house, breaks, DnB, hip hop, funk and disco. Their influences are equally diverse. Muzza was inspired by the rave scene of the early 90's, attending events such as the infamous Castlemorton and the original Universe Tribal Gathering . Dom's inspiration came from being regularly blown away by Dean Anderson's legendary eclectic sets at The Bomb in Nottingham. They teamed up in 2003 and found a way of using and fusing their influences, resulting in dancefloors full of smiles, moving feet and often raised hands.
